ATTENTION!!! Refracta Installer Bug If you chose "Sudo as default, disable root account" in versions 9.6.0 through 9.6.4 of refractainstaller, you have a passowrdless root account. To fix and existing installation, run 'sudo passwd -l root' to lock the root account. This bug was fixed in 9.6.5 but I like the fix in 9.6.6 better. I made symlinks for 9.6.5 so that some weblinks will still work, but it turns out that the symlinks don't work. - fsmithred NOTE: refractasnapshot and refractainstaller: gui packages require base packages. Use latest available version of -gui with latest version of -base, even if numbers are different. refractainstaller base and gui (9.6.3) * Fixed removal of diversion of anacron. * Remove user from sudo group. refractainstaller-base (9.6.0) * Add support for runit. (Disable console autologin) * Remove diversion of anacron made by live-config. * Better keyboard selection (-plow) in loc-timezn.sh * Update change-username with some code improvements. * Delete root pass if sudo is default and don't ask to change root pass. * Add config file option to install grub-efi to removable media path also. refractasnapshot-base (10.2.11) * Move live-config-sysvinit, etc. to Recommends to allow installation with runit or other init. refracta2usb (2.4.3) * Update patch-initrd for live-boot 1:20190614 (buster/beowulf) * New boot splash refractainstaller (-base and -gui 9.5.6) * Run choose_grub() if grub-pc package gets installed. (Closes: 485) * rsync no longer deletes any files on target. refractainstaller-gui (9.5.5) (use this with 9.5.4 -base package) * Fix typo in cryptsetup command. refractasnapshot (10.2.10) * Updated splash, isolinux.bin, chain.c32, vesamenu.c32 * Copy filesystem before editing initramfs. * Remove resume from filesystem copy when editing initramfs. refractainstaller (9.5.4) * Exclude .kde/share/config/kdesurc * fstab fixes for swap and /boot/efi * Make some static entries in /dev * Use luks1 format for encrypted /boot. (Debian bug #927165) * Let terminal die when finished. (gui package only) refractasnapshot- 10.2.9 unstable; urgency=low * Fix typos in extract_initrd() * Remove cryptroot/crypttab from initrd.img refractasnapshot- 10.2.6 unstable; urgency=low * Change /dev/shm from symlink to directory. (Debian bug #851427) * extract_initrd() now works with microcode. * Removed old nocrypt.sh script. refracta2usb 2.4.2 * Remove null column in partition list window * Expand search pattern to find more partitions refractainstaller 9.5.1 - 9.5.3 * Remove option to keep old home. * Remove null column from yad partition/drive lists. * Test partitions greater than 9. (cli only) * Don't require partitions to end in digit. (allow lvm, cli only) * Don't add esp to fstab in bios boot. * Test for GRUB_ENABLE_CRYPTODISK before adding it. * Exclude leftover polkit files from live-config. * Remove uefi bootloader warning from bios install. * Add /run/live/medium to test for live session. refracta2usb 2.4.1 * Set root path to include sbin directories. (for Debian Buster or Devuan Beo$ refracta2usb 2.4.0 * Updated patch-initrd files for live-boot-20170112 for Debian Stretch or Devuan ASCII. refractainstaller 9.5.0~fsr * Set root path to include sbin directories. (for Debian Buster or Devuan Beowulf) * Eliminate sudo/su question in wrapper script. Try sudo first. * Shorten log name to refractainstaller.log * Changed yad version test to 0.27 or newer needed. (This is a guess.) * Changed wording for sshd_config (s/without-password/prohibit-password) refractasnapshot 10.2.0~fsr * Set root path to include sbin directories. (for Debian Buster or Devuan Beowulf) * Fixed missing grub splash in uefi boot. * Choose task first, get disk report only with full snapshot. * Put report in text-info window so it has scroll bars and fits on screen. * Merge grub-efi warning into main report. * Automate the encryption confusion: * Test initrd for cryptsetup. Rebuild with CRYPTSETUP=y if needed. * Test initrd for conf.d/resume and cryptroot. Remove if present. * Update ssh_config wording. * Replaced dysfunctional progress bar in check_space() with info window. * Test for config file after command-line options. * Changed name of log to refractasnapshot.log * Make help screen available within program. * Added '-iso-level 3' to xorriso command for isos larger than 4GB. refractainstaller-base/gui (9.4.3) unstable; urgency=low * Use zless to read gzipped installer_help file. * Fixed 'disable tdm autologin' * Improved wording in username_dialog for sudo options.(gui) refractasnapshot-gui (10.0.3) unstable; urgency=low * Re-enabled cleanup option in '01 Create a snapshot' * Added /etc/popularity-contest.conf to excludes. * Fixed removal of NetworkManager/system-connections/* * Media volume label is is now a variable in config file. refractainstaller-gui (9.4.2) unstable; urgency=low * Add support for virtual disks (/dev/vd[a-z]) * sudo-for-shutdown box no longer pre-checked. * Add test to copy_grub_packages() * Remove Recommends. (-base pkg has it) refractainstaller-gui (9.4.1) unstable; urgency=low * Do not re-use $home_part for crypttab. Use new var. * Do not mount $home_part to target_home if keeping old /home. refractainstaller-base (9.4.0) * Use LC_ALL=C for fdisk -l to accommodate other locales. * Test for gpt and for BIOS boot partition. * Test that selected partitions end in digit. * Use gdisk if gpt present, for both bios and uefi boot. * Use default reserved blocks with new ext filesystems. * Test for unformatted EFI partition. * Allow re-run partitioner within the installer. * Improved test_hostname() to play nice with xgettext. (Blinkdog) * Add '-k all' to update-initramfs for cryptsetup. * umount /target/boot/efi in cleanup. * Add lxdm autologin settings. * Allow full-disk encryption (encrypted /boot in root filesystem) * use_uuid for crypttab. refractainstaller-base (9.3.3) * select_grub_dev if grub-pc is copied to /target and installed. * Include German translation file. refractainstaller-base (9.3.2) * Fixed disable autologin when sudo is default. refractasnapshot-base (10.1.1) * Added boot option 'net.ifnames=0' refractainstaller-base (9.3.1) * Changed y/n answers to numeric for easier translations. refractainstaller-gui (9.2.3) * Fixed some typos. * Wrapper script starts installer in debug mode for verbose log. * Exclude dbus/machine-id and popularity-contest.conf. refractasnapshot-base (10.1.0) (10.0.2 gui will work with this) * Added excludes for /usr/lib/live where /lib is symlink. (for stretch/ascii) * Re-enabled cleanup option in '01 Create a snapshot' * Added /etc/popularity-contest.conf to excludes. * Fixed removal of NetworkManager/system-connections/* * Media volume-ID is is now a variable in config file. refractainstaller-base (9.3.0) (9.2.2 gui will work with this) * Exclude /etc/popularity-contest.conf so each install gets new ID. * Added support for uefi install. * Added excludes for /usr/lib/live where /lib is symlink. * Added no-format option to cli installer. refractainstaller (9.2.2 gui only, works with 9.2.1 base) * Wrapper script tests for efi and selects correct installer. * Better instructions at chroot terminal. * Look for 'EFI System' in fdisk output, not just 'EFI' * Simple install gets pre/post install scripts. * Require text-entry if two EFI partitions are present. refracta2usb (2.3.6) * Added text-info window with old grub.cfg if efi files are replaced. * Added union=overlay to menu options window. * Added help text for multiboot usb toram. * Added help button (More) to set_menu_options, shows 'man live-boot'. refractainstaller (9.2.1) * Included refractainstaller-uefi and uefi_install.readme in package. * Fixed regression. disable_auto_console gets set with disable_auto_desktop again. * Replaced cfdisk with cgdisk in uefi installer. * Reversed listing of filesystem types; ext4 is now first. * Added support for text translations. * Added support for nvme disks and sd/mmc devices. * Removed obsolete code relating to clamav. * EFI partition found with fdisk; parted is not needed. refractasnapshot (10.0.2) * Oops! 10.0.1 was uploaded too soon. * Ready for language translation, really, I think. * Other than that, same as 10.0.1 refractasnapshot (10.0.1) * Recommends dosfstools. UEFI snapshot boots to grub prompt without it. * Added test and warning if dosfstools is not installed and make_efi=yes. * Replaced md5sum with sha256sum. * Added test for missing configfile. * Removed zenity from Depends. * Ready for language translation. refracta2usb-2.3.5 * functions.common: Changed /dev/disk/by-id to by-uuid for vdev. refractainstaller-base 9.1.9-1 * Fixed regression in cli script. * disable_auto_console gets set with disable_auto_desktop again Refractasnapshot changes 10.0.0 * Added support for uefi-bootable iso. * See full changelog in package for beta01-beta05 changes. * Refractasnapshot recommends refracta-lang (in the Extras folder.) refracta2usb changes 2.3.4 * Replaced missing line break in menu_text in refracta2usb line 340. refracta2usb changes 2.3.3 * Added yet another location to find syslinux mbr.bin * Changed config to components in f5.txt boot help. * Added more missing dollar signs. * More configurable boot options. * Added support for xed, nemo, pluma, caja (for mate and cinnamon) * Removed live-boot and live-config from Depends. Not needed. * Fixed Bug: non-tabbed editors were not showing the grub menu. refracta2usb changes 2.3.0-2.3.2 * Fixed version number in control file and script. * Added missing dollar signs for translation. * Fixed menu generation for copy from multiboot usb. * Added support for UEFI. * EFI files in iso get copied to usb. * Boot menu entries get created for syslinux and grub-efi. * Replaced archivemount with lsinitramfs in test for askpass. * Removed/disabled support for zenity. (long ago broken by yad forms) Refracta installer changes 9.1.9 * Fixed bug. Username now gets changed in display manger config if you allow autologin on the installed system. * Fixed bug. /swapfile was getting listed in fstab twice. Refractasnapshot changes 9.3.4 * Changed "config=" to "components=" in stock boot help f5.txt * Added support for netman/simple-netaid to keep or remove configs. * Added hexchat logs to rsync excludes list. * Use variable $initrd_image, not file name in preparing encryption. Refractasnapshot changes 9.3.0 - 9.3.3 * Removed patch for /usr/share/initramfs-tools/init. * Added code to create static device nodes in /dev. * Removed "union=aufs" from boot commands. (for stretch/sid) * Rename memtest86+.bin to memtest on live media, so it works. * Removed code for clamav init links. * Added chain.c32 to list of copied isolinux modules. * Moved check for previous init patch after greeting window. * Open /usr/share/initramfs-tools/init in editor, run update-initramfs * Replaced target/dev with "$work_dir"/dev * username=<username> added to boot menu if name is not "user". refractasnapshot-9.2.2 changes (05 Feb 2016) * Added reminder to turn off numlock. * Fixed stdmenu.cfg to point to isolinux subdirectory for splash image. * Added code from live-build to blank systemd's /etc/machine-id * Centered yad/zenity windows. refractainstaller 9.1.8 * Added support for slim login manager to disable autologin. refractainstaller-gui-9.1.7 changes (05 Feb 2016) * Fixed bug in test for live session. * Removed support for zenity. refracta2usb (2.2.0) * Updated patch-initrd to live-boot-20160511 (currently sid) * Skipped version numbers for easy recognition. * Updated sample boot menu entries in help file. * Added "union=aufs" to options selection window for boot menu. refracta2usb (2.0.1) * Centered dialog windows. * Fixed typo in menu creation for mkpersist - ${netconfig_opt} * Changed tools menu item "Delete_folder" to "File_manager". refractainstaller-gui-9.1.6-1 changes: * Yad windows are centered. refractainstaller-9.1.6 changes: * Detect swap partitions, choose from list. * Moved grub from Depends to Recommends. Refracta Installer and Snapshot 9.1.x, 9.2x work on Wheezy and Jessie (For Stretch or Sid, remove "union=aufs" from the boot command line, or change it to "union=overlay".). refracta2usb-0.9.7 works on Wheezy only. Older tools (for Wheezy only, and maybe Squeeze) are in the older_versions directory.
refracta Files
Brought to you by:
fsmithred